This is a problem, my IOMEGA ZIP Drive is running on Parallel Port.
My F-BSD version is 2.2.8.
Can anybody point how to get my zip working?

> I've only experience with the IDE version of the ZIP drive.  It works
> fine as the IDE floppy device (/dev/wfd0).  You just need to make sure
> that
> 
> options         ATAPI   #Enable ATAPI support for IDE bus
> device          wfd0
> 
> are in your kernel configuration.  If you are still using the
> uncustomized kernel that came with 2.2.8-Release, then it's already
> enabled.  Just use /dev/wfd0 as any other drive.  I've used it for both
> MSDOS and UFS type filesystems.  It's my only backup device.
> 
> The SCSI version would work well also.
> 
> I don't know if there is a driver for the parallel port ZIP drive.
